Bunny hopping in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) is a technique that takes advantage of the game's physics engine to achieve faster movement compared to standard running. The science behind this maneuver lies in the way players can manipulate their character's velocity. By timing their jumps correctly and using the strafe keys (A and D) while jumping, players can maintain their forward momentum without losing speed. This creates a fluid motion that allows players to navigate maps more quickly, outmaneuvering opponents who rely solely on conventional movement.
Another key aspect of the bunny hopping technique is its reliance on precise timing and coordination. Players must time their jumps to land on the ground while simultaneously executing strafe movements, which can be challenging to master. To achieve optimal results, many players recommend using a combination of audio cues and visual indicators. For instance, listening for the sound of landing and observing the character's animation can help players refine their timing. As they improve, the effectiveness of bunny hopping becomes evident, allowing them to dodge bullets and traverse the battlefield with greater agility, making it a critical component of advanced gameplay strategies in CS2.
Bunny hopping is a popular technique in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) that can enhance your mobility and make you a more elusive target. However, many players fall into common traps while trying to master this movement skill. One of the most frequent mistakes is failing to time your jumps correctly. A well-timed bunny hop requires precise coordination between your jump key and movement controls. If you jump too early or too late, you risk losing momentum. To maximize your bunny hopping potential, practice maintaining a rhythmic movement, ensuring that each jump follows the last in a seamless pattern.
Another prevalent mistake is not utilizing the mouse's directional control effectively. When executing a bunny hop, players often neglect to turn their mouse to guide their character effectively. This lack of directional control can lead to disorientation and a loss of speed. It's crucial to incorporate mouse movements in tandem with keyboard inputs to maintain velocity and control. A good practice technique is to focus on turning your mouse slightly in the direction of your jumps, allowing for smoother landings and enhanced acceleration.
